How to File a Boat Accident Claim

A victim must be in a position to establish that a vessel operator or owner owes them an obligation of care. They must also prove that they did not meet this duty and that their negligence contributed to the accident. They must also show that the accident injured them and that their injuries resulted damages.

Duty of care

When a boat accident occurs, the first step is to call for medical attention. This will help ensure that the person who was injured is not getting worse and also provide documentation of their injuries. This is vital to establishing who is responsible in a lawsuit.

The next step is to determine who is accountable for the incident. The operator of the boat, the vessel owner, and others who were on board could all be held liable. The marina owner or the dock owner could also be accountable for the accident in the event it occurred on their property.

Boat accidents are often caused by carelessness. Inattention, recklessness and failure to follow the rules of boating are all examples of negligence. This includes operating a boat when under the influence of alcohol or illegal drugs.

The defendant is bound by the duty of care to the plaintiff. This duty must be violated, and it must have directly caused the plaintiff's injuries. Damages have to be determined which could include medical expenses as well as loss of income as well as emotional trauma, pain and suffering. In some cases an injury may aggravate a pre-existing health condition. These conditions can be considered in the damages claim. Negligence

Failure of an individual to act or their actions can be deemed negligent. A Virginia boat accident attorney could claim that the owner of a boat failed to exercise reasonable care in a circumstance that caused an accident.

If someone's negligence causes a boat accident, they may be liable for the damages and injuries suffered by the victims. A lawsuit or claim against the negligent party may include the reimbursement of medical expenses or lost wages and property damage, as well as the pain and suffering.

The first step is to show that the defendant breached their duty of care. The next step is to prove causality, which is the connection between the breach of duty and the plaintiff's injury or losses. The final step is to establish damages, which are actual financial losses the plaintiff has suffered.

Damages

The amount of compensation you receive depends on the severity of your injuries and impact on your life. The most common damages are medical expenses loss of income, pain and suffering. Medical expenses could include hospital expenses, surgery costs, prescriptions and physical therapy. A Virginia injury lawyer will determine all medical expenses that are or will be associated with your accident. Loss of income will be accounted for in any wages or benefits that you didn't receive because of your injuries. Your lawyer can refer you to an expert in vocational law to determine how your injuries have affected your ability to earn in the future.

Non-economic damages are a bit harder to quantify but can include compensation for your emotional distress, physical suffering and mental pain and disfigurement as well as loss of enjoyment of life. Your attorney will establish the full extent of your damages, and will aggressively pursue fair compensation on your behalf.

Liability in boating accident is usually determined by whether the person at fault violated their duty of care, for instance when they committed an illegal act like boating drunk. It is often more difficult to determine the liability in boating accidents caused by the lack of safety equipment. For instance, the absence of life jackets, flares or whistles, or fire extinguishers can make it harder to rescue a person who has fallen overboard.
